What affects the price

Cruise pricing shifts based on a few key variables. Your cabin category is the biggest factor; choosing a suite or a room with a balcony naturally costs more than an interior cabin. Where you choose to sail and how far out you book also play a significant role. Last-minute deals can sometimes save you money, but booking early often secures better perks or specific room locations. What is the cheapest month to cruise?

Generally, the cheapest months to cruise are September, October, and January, following the summer vacation season and before the spring break rush. These periods often have lower demand, leading to more affordable fares. Call us to explore budget-friendly adults-only cruise options.
